Output ef4dccb6f52d27dc7db60b93a4bac0d254287bfd80bbcc65333fa06a90f9602a:1

value
4439288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3afda0b999c2e173292bd2a8158139bde9e7a0 OP_EQUAL
address
3BNiDdFVGxXQa4XA2evg2UpsyBphVixx8W
transaction
ef4dccb6f52d27dc7db60b93a4bac0d254287bfd80bbcc65333fa06a90f9602a
spent
true